Abstract
⺠HER2 overexpression enhances AhR mRNA and protein levels. ⺠HER2/MEK/ERK signal increases transcription of AhR mRNA. ⺠AhR Inhibition reduces HER2-mediated induction of IL-6 mRNA and mammosphere formation. ⺠Results suggest HER2/AhR signaling is important for maintenance of cancer stem cells in HER2-overexpressing breast cancer cells.
